Winter brings a drop in temperatures and home sales: 

December 2, 2025 — For November 2025, the Greater Edmonton Area (GEA) real estate market reported 1,654 sales, a 19.7% decrease compared to activity in October 2025 and a 13.5% decrease compared to November 2024. There were 2,281 new properties listed, decreasing 27.9% month-over-month, tracking 11.0% higher year-over-year. Inventory levels fell 10.6% from the previous month but are 33.3% higher compared to the previous year.

Building on a very strong start to the year, commercial real estate investors remained extremely optimistic in the Edmonton market through the second quarter of 2025.

From April through June, 183 transactions closed, bringing an additional $854.2 million in property and land sales. Compared to mid-year 2024, investment was up across all six asset classes we track, and this propelled year-to-date investment to an 80% year-over-year (y-o-y) increase in year-to-date investment from a little more than $1.9 billion at June 30th, 2024 to approximately $2.1 billion at the same time this year.

Cooling market still seeing some heat in semi-detached units

Edmonton, AB – October 2, 2025 — Housing activity in the Greater Edmonton Area (GEA) real estate market during the month of September included 3,645 new listings added to the market and 2,192 units sold. Compared to the previous month, these figures represent a 0.1% increase in new listings and a 7.8% decrease in sales. Year-over-year the change is 16.3% more listings added and 2.9% fewer sales. This difference has created a 25.6% increase in available inventory compared to a year ago.

Summer market definitively over as sales and listings fall

Edmonton, AB – September 2, 2025 —Activity in the Greater Edmonton Area (GEA) real estate market slowed in August, selling 2,382 units to mark a decrease of 16.7% from July 2025 and 7.8% from August 2024. Although new listings dropped by 10.5% month-over-month, they are still up 11.6% from last year, driving inventory levels 24.6% higher than in August 2024. Average days on market has also begun to increase, taking four days longer on average to sell a property in August 2025.
